The so-called living in a castle is actually a room converted from a stable. The room is very small and the shapes inside the room are also different, so it is easy to hit your head. But apart from the above objective conditions, I think all the aspects are good. The breakfast is very good. You eat on the first floor of the stable. The coffee is amazing. The water and milk in the small refrigerator upstairs are very good. The waiter is very responsible for introducing each family and taking them to check in. The so-called castle is a relatively large house, not even as big as some old houses of Fujian people. It cannot be considered as a castle. The garden... well... is not as flowery as the Imperial Garden of the Forbidden City. The plants are mainly succulents. It is not necessary to expect to see flowers, but it is also a feature. The most recommended is dinner. You can make an appointment for dinner when staying here. It is a rare highlight of the food in this New Zealand trip. There are only four dishes, which are exquisite and attentive, and taste good. If you don't mind sharing the hall with strangers, you can experience the long table dinner and have a drink and chat with the neighbors who live in the stable that night. The English spoken in one night is almost the sum of the past two years. It is very relaxing and happy.

In the scenic area, you need to click on the iron gate when checking in, otherwise you will not be able to enter the scenic area. You can order dinner in the castle. It seems to be 90 New Zealand dollars per person. The stable room where I live is in the attic on the second floor. There is enough space to store two boxes. Breakfast is very good. It is English breakfast with buffet + set menu. We didn’t finish the meal, so we took it away and went to Sandfly Bay for Chinese food. Get up early and visit the gardens and castle. Staying here is equivalent to visiting the castle for free. It smells great.
